PALM SPRINGS – We’re humming along a quiet suburban road outside this popular tourist destination on a clear, cool March morning. It’s only around 8 a.m., but already the dun-coloured mountains off to the northeast look like they’re already baked to a crisp. Our Desert Adventures Red Jeep Tours guide, Mike Groves, tells members of our tour group (my wife, Barbara, plus my Dad and his ladyfriend, Lucy) to look more closely at some of the small valleys and impressions on the side of the hills.
